Freelancing
You can find the email of the section editor you are interested in freelancing for on our Staff page.
As a freelance writer or photographer, you have the freedom to decide each week whether to receive an assignment from a section editor. Once an assignment is accepted, you are expected to see it to completion. If you are unsure which type of journalism you are interested in, wanting to gain crucial hands-on experience, looking to show your commitment in preparation for a staff position at the Chimes, or simply curious to see if journalism is the right field for you, then freelancing is a great option!
